Before we dive into methods of control, getting acquainted with the anatomy of a mosquito can offer insightful knowledge that can be practically applied. Let's delve into some fascinating facts.
Mosquitoes have a slender segmented body that is intricately structured to facilitate their survival in various environments. This structure includes a pair of wings and three pairs of long hair-like legs. The mosquito's head hosts sensory antennae and a proboscis, the latter being the organ responsible for those irritating bites as it facilitates feeding on blood from humans and animals.

Mosquitoes come with an array of specialized abilities that facilitate their survival and make them quite adept at being nuisances. Aside from being drawn to carbon dioxide and body heat, they have excellent vision, especially in low-light conditions, which helps them to locate their targets with remarkable precision.
Their agility in flight is backed by a rapid wing beat frequency, which, combined with their lightweight bodies, allows for quick and abrupt take-offs and landings. The sensory organs of mosquitoes are highly developed, enabling them to detect the slightest chemical signals. Their antennae are not just for show; they house receptors that can detect the scent of our skin and even the heat emitted from our bodies.
This highly developed sensory system, combined with their physical attributes, makes mosquitoes formidable in locating their food sources – us.

Sometimes, mosquito bites can lead to more severe reactions, especially in individuals with immune system issues or allergies to mosquito saliva. If you notice symptoms such as high fever, hives, swollen lymph nodes, or difficulty breathing, it is crucial to seek medical attention promptly. It's always better to be safe and consult with a healthcare provider in case of unusual or severe reactions to mosquito bites.
